I've found money a lot tighter too. When you reach ~500 industry score (so 1840 if your UK :)) all your artisans will stop working at once causing you to lose a sizable amount of tax. Whats even more fun is when your overproducing wool so all your indian farmers stop working but won't move. If you want to keep a decent sized army you need to inflate your industry score to plug the hole left by the artisans.

Unfortunately I find UK falls off the top spot all on its own. It has terrible lit for a western nation, too many pops so even NF clergy takes 30 years to hit 2% and a rubbish tech school. It can't colonize because the only techs it has are economic and naval since it has so few points. If it gets into a serious war while its economy isn't at its strongest it racks up so much debt its interest outweighs its income so the next war it has no army or navy with min sliders trying not to go bankrupt. Prussia and USA usually end up taking the top spots, maybe with France if they industrialized early enough.
For a player its even easier to screw UK over, just invade the mainland while you distract its navy at the other side of the world, England can barely field any units outside of India until its industry takes off.

Of course you do still get some games where UK just builds the entire global market and ends with like 20000 industrial on top of its insane prestige and military scores, but that's quite a bit rarer now.
